Information Minister: The Development Fund is a national step for reconstruction

Published: 2025/09/05 3:09 PM
Updated: 2025/09/05 3:10 PM
Information Minister: The Development Fund is a national step for reconstruction

Damascus, SANA – Minister of Information Hamza al-Mustafa affirmed that the launch of the Syrian Development Fund represents a comprehensive national path for reconstruction and reflects an active popular will to shoulder national responsibility, independent of the political conditions imposed by international organizations.

In a speech during the fund’s launch, Minister al-Mustafa said: “The Syrian government has chosen an independent path that allows all citizens to contribute to building their future.” He added: “Syrians today are masters of their national decision.”

Mustafa indicated that addressing the refugee camps is a priority for the next phase, emphasizing that the concept of camps imposed by the former regime must end.

The Minister articulated that the Syrian Development Fund is professionally organized and aims to attract donations from individuals, companies, and countries. He noted that the donation campaign launched on Thursday has received an overwhelming response, with more than $61 million raised despite some technical issues on the website, and the campaign is scheduled to continue for three days, with the possibility of extension, and donations remain open to all.

Mustafa concluded by emphasizing that the post-liberation phase requires strengthening the country’s unity and the cohesion of Syrian society, calling for overcoming differences and working together to build a unified and stable Syria.
